As the name suggests, the Chinese fringe (Chionanthus retusus) tree is native to China, Korea and Japan. It is an easy-to-grow, very hardy tree with beautiful, leathery foliage and unique bark in ...
Chinese fringe trees grow in USDA hardiness zones 5 to 9 and reach a height and width of 10 to 20 feet. A slow-growing tree, it makes a fantastic specimen tree or foundation tree near your house.
